Subsequently, how do I redirect a page not found in WordPress?

How to redirect 404 error page to homepage in WordPress

  1. In Tools > Redirection > Add new redirection.
  2. In the Source URL box, type or paste the broken/old/altered URL.
  3. In the Target URL box, type or paste the new URL.
  4. Opt for URL and referrer in the match drop down.
  5. In the Action box, chose Redirect to URL.

How do I redirect all 404 to the homepage with redirection plugin?

To enable the plugin, go to Settings >> All 404 Redirect to Homepage settings page. Then set the 404 Redirection Status to Enabled. Enter the URL of your homepage in the Redirect all 404 pages to section to redirect all 404 pages to your homepage. Click on Update Options button to save the changes.

What does Page Not Found 404 mean?

A 404 error message is a Hypertext Transfer Protocol (HTTP) status code indicating the server could not find the requested website. In other words, your web browser can connect with the server, but the specific page you’re trying to access can’t be reached.

What is a 302 temporary redirect?

The HyperText Transfer Protocol (HTTP) 302 Found redirect status response code indicates that the resource requested has been temporarily moved to the URL given by the Location header.

Why do I keep getting 404 not found?

You might see a 404 error because of a problem with the website, because the page was moved or deleted, or because you typed the URL wrong. 404 errors are less common today than they used to be, as websites now strive to automatically redirect visitors away from deleted pages.
